Raksha Medal 1965

Raksha Medal 1965

Authority

President’s Secretariat Notification No 14-Pres/65 dated 26 Jan 67 as amended vide Notification No 73-Pres/71 dated 14 Dec 71.

Conditions of Eligibility and Eligible categories

  • All Armed Forces personnel who were borne on the effective strength of the Armed Forces on the 5 Aug 65 and had rendered service for 180 days or more on that date
  • Personnel of the units of Para-military forces as were under the operational control of the Army and had rendered service for 180 days or more on the 5 Aug 65; and
  • Personnel of the units of Para-military forces who were operationally committed and were in the areas which qualify for Samar Seva Star 1965, subject to fulfilling the condition regarding length of service as (b) above can be awarded posthumously.

Design of the Medal and Riband

Medal Circular in shape, made of cupro-nickel, 35mm in diameter. It shall have embossed on its obverse the State Emblem 22 mm in height. On its reverse it shall have embossed in the centre the rising sun with sprays of laurel below on either side and the inscription embossed above it.

Riband Orange in colour, divided into four equal parts by three vertical stripes, each 3 mm in width of red, dark blue and light blue. The award may be made posthumously.
